Activation of Presenter Add-in in Powerpoint is not possible

Ciao,

I have installed Adobe Presenter 10 64bit. When working in Powerpoint 2013 I got the message "Presenter detected an unexpected problem". So I had to deactivate the plug in. Once I wanted to reactivate it did not work any more , it just ignored my checkmark and deleted it again.

I then found the recommendation to delete the plug in and to add it again. Now I get the error message that the file MenuLaunch.dll is not a valid file. I am quite desperate as I am under time preassure.

Any body who can help?

Fix:

While disabling the Presenter plugin form PowerPoint, sometimes registry entry for the Presenter Application gets deleted as well.

Due to this, Presenter ribbon is no more visible in the PowerPoint and also manually adding the Plugin does not help, because we do not have registry entries for Presenter anymore.

In such a case, uninstalling and re-installing the Presenter application fixes the issue.

Ciao Zeeshan,

thank you for your reply.

I followed this tutorial already and found the following problem:

Go to the location H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E > Software > Microsoft >Office > 15.0 > ClickToRun > REGISTRY > MACHINE > Software > Wow6432Node > Microsoft > Office > PowerPoint >AddIns >AdobePresenter.COMAddin.

My folder stops here: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E > Software > Microsoft >Office > 15.0 >

No ClickToRun can be found in my registry.

Any help is appreciated
